Java Developer

от 80 000 до 200 000 руб. на руки

Требуемый опыт работы: 3–6 лет

Полная занятость, удаленная работа

Возможно временное оформление: договор услуг, подряда, ГПХ, самозанятые, ИП

Мы создаем широкий спектр программного обеспечения для бизнеса – от веб-приложений до программно-аппаратных комплексов и высоконагруженных облачных систем. Если хочешь принять участие в разработке интересных и разнообразных проектов - предлагаем тебе присоединиться к нашей команде.

Что делать:

  • работать в распределенной команде;
  • следовать принципам Agile;
  • участвовать во внутренних и внешних проектах;
  • разрабатывать новые и поддерживать существующие системы;
  • покрывать код тестами;
  • участвовать в проектировании систем и выборе технологий;

Необходимые знания:

  • знание Java;
  • отличное знание Spring (Spring Boot, Spring JPA, Spring Cloud);
  • знание Maven / Gradle;
  • знание docker;
  • знание SQL на уровне сложных выборок и оптимизации запросов;
  • умение писать тесты с использованием JUnit;
  • командная строка linux;
  • понимание микросервисной архитектуры;
  • знание ООП и шаблонов проектирования, а так же умение их применять на практике;
  • умение работать с системой контроля версий GIT (или подобной);
  • оконченное высшее образование по технической специальности.

Будет плюсом:

  • умение работать с Kubernetes;
  • участие в разработке веб-проектов с большой нагрузкой;
  • опыт работы с не реляционными СУБД;
  • знание Swagger / OpenApi;
  • умение работать в команде;
  • опыт работы с RabbitMQ или другими системами обмена сообщений;

Ключевые навыки

Java
Spring Framework
SQL
Docker

Вакансия опубликована 24 июля 2021 в Москве

Похожие вакансии